I need to insert a comment and then insert a picture to display inside that comment. I am finding many explanations online (YouTube, forums, etc.) for how to do so in previous versions of Office, but I cannot find any explanation for how to do so in 2016 Excel for Mac.
My hang-up is editing the format of the comment in order to allow me to insert the picture. There is no 'Comment Format Colors and Lines Color Drop-down Fill Effects Picture' option on my end (which is the solution I found for Office 2011 Mac). The 'comment format' for me is limited to 'Font, Protection, Alignment, Properties' none of which has the solution, at least to my knowledge. You can use VBA (Visual Basic for Applications) to insert a picture into a comment box. This code sample shows how to enlarge a comment box and then insert a picture into it. Sub FormatMyCommentBox Range('B2').Comment.Shape.Select True Selection.ShapeRange.ScaleWidth 3.53, msoFalse, msoScaleFromTopLeft Selection.ShapeRange.ScaleHeight 3.16, msoFalse, msoScaleFromTopLeft Selection.ShapeRange.Fill.UserPicture 'Macintosh HD:Users:libjbg:Pictures:ubblue.jpg' End Sub I am an unpaid volunteer and do not work for Microsoft.
